What Is an AOS Degree in Infotech?
An Associate in Occupational Researches (AOS) in Infotech is a career-oriented degree that mixes class theory with real-world application. Unlike traditional associate degrees that emphasize general education, the AOS degree focuses mainly on job-specific training and technical ability advancement. This makes it a strong selection for trainees who want to get in the workforce rapidly with a strong foundation in IT.

This IT Degree normally covers core areas such as networking, cybersecurity, computer system systems, hardware and software support, data source management, and programs. Trainees additionally gain analytical skills and experience with industry-standard tools and systems that companies value.

Secret Features of an Infotech (AOS) Program
Hands-On Training:
AOS programs are understood for their useful method. Students typically deal with real-world jobs, mimic IT circumstances, and gain experience with existing innovations.

Industry-Relevant Educational program:
Coursework is created to line up with current patterns and company assumptions. Topics may consist of network management, information safety, systems analysis, and computer assistance.

Certification Preparation:
Many AOS degree programs prepare pupils for industry-recognized certifications such as CompTIA A+, Network+, Safety and security+, and Cisco's CCNA.

Versatile Learning Options:
Programs might supply both day and night classes, online learning, and crossbreed styles to accommodate different schedules and way of livings.

Occupation Solutions Assistance:
Leading IT schools help pupils with resume composing, interview preparation, and task positioning to help them land positions after graduation.

Profession Opportunities with an IT Degree
Graduates with an Information Technology Degree from an AOS program are gotten ready for a range of entry-level duties in the technology market, such as:

IT Support Specialist

Network Manager

Computer Service technician

Assist Workdesk Analyst

Equipments Administrator

Cybersecurity Specialist

With more education and experience, these functions can result in senior placements such as IT Supervisor, Network Designer, or Information Safety Analyst.
